Position Description

The Innovative Genomics Institute at the University of California, Berkeley seeks applications for a Postdoctoral Scholar Employee in the Advanced Translational Genetics (ATG) Lab, in the area of stem cell disease modeling and precision medicine.

The ATG Lab investigates the genetic and molecular underpinnings of human disease through the integration of high-throughput pluripotent stem cell (PSC) models. By combining precise genome editing, automated cell engineering, and multiplexed CRISPR screening with single-cell multi-omics and AI modeling, we are building a state-of-the-art cell type-specific disease modeling that provide unique therapeutic discovery platforms. Our mission is to decode complex disease mechanisms and accelerate the development of precision medicine across a broad spectrum of conditions, including oncology, neurodevelopmental and neurodegenerative disorders, and metabolic diseases.

Responsibilities

The successful candidate will play a pivotal role in advancing our research through three primary functional domains:

Advanced Genome Engineering & Characterization

  • Lead projects under the guidance of the Principal Investigator that involve engineering, differentiation to disease relevant cell types and functional characterization of human induced pluripotent stem cells (iPSCs).
  • Execute complex molecular biology workflows, including large-scale tissue culture, PCR, NGS sequencing, high-resolution imaging, and biochemical functional assays to validate disease models.

Scaled CRISPR Discovery

  • Design and execute sophisticated CRISPR screening campaigns, from library design and molecular cloning to lentiviral production.
  • Manage scaled cell culture operations to support high-throughput genetic perturbations and therapeutic discovery.

Multi-Omic Data Integration & AI Modeling

  • Develop and implement computational pipelines to analyze multi-module phenotypic data.
  • Utilize pathway analysis and artificial intelligence (AI) modeling to derive biological insights and identify novel therapeutic targets from complex datasets.

In addition to overseeing their own research projects, the Postdoctoral Employee is expected to provide mentoring within the ATG research team.

  • Mentorship & Collaboration: Provide technical guidance and professional mentorship to graduate and undergraduate students, fostering a collaborative and inclusive lab environment.
  • Scientific Communication: Lead the preparation of high-impact manuscripts for peer-reviewed journals and present research findings at national and international conferences.
  • Grant Development: Support the lab's sustainability by contributing preliminary data and strategic writing to federal and private grant proposals (e.g., NIH, NSF).
